Photos- June 1997

There were no pictures taken of me at my lowest weight. These were taken after I had gained around 30- to 35 pounds. All these photos were taken after I was released from the hospital where my lowest weight recorded was 85 pounds. I am 5' 9 1/2" tall with large bone structure. It was documented that I was 52% of my ideal weight.

Convention was amazing!!







Going to the LDS Bookseller's convention yesterday was one of the neatest experiences yet concerning my book. I was able to place tons of books to store owners all over the nation. I remember visiting with people from New York, Michigan, Arizona, Las Vegas, Washington, and more!

There was such a great reception to my book, better than I could have imagined! A representative from Deseret Book was ecstatic about my book, she said there are not very many resources covering eating disorders right now. She said lots of people have come into her store asking for literature and she has nothing to revere them to, except one small talk on CD.

I also met a lady who's sister died of anorexia. She for sure will be selling my book in her store. She hugged me and was so happy that I made it through this powerful disorder.

Almost EVERY person in my line said they knew someone that had an eating disorder. I was amazed at how many people said "I'm so happy this book is out there! This is so needed right now!"

People that didn't know someone effected by the disease were so excited to read about my spiritual occurrences that happened while I was in between life and death.

Several store owners came up to my booth after being told "You have to go check this book out" by other store owners!

Brandon walked around the conference and said I had more people in line than any other's he saw!!!!

One lady told me that my book needs to go national! "This needs to go big." She said. She went on and on about it.
